The Far North Coast Junior Dance Ensemble is for talented dance students from NSW public schools in Year 5 to Year 8. Boys are strongly encouraged to apply.

Membership is by audition only and is open to students attending NSW public schools living in the Far North Coast.

This ensemble is aimed at talented dance students who display a high level of technical skill and performance quality and wish be involved in the choreographic process to create, learn and perform a dance work at the Far North Coast Dance Festival. This ensemble will also audition to perform at State Dance Festival.

Successful applicants will be working collaboratively with Anouska Gammon Anouska Gammon – an active choreographer for NSW State Dance Ensembles and festivals, and a lecturer at Southern Cross University in Creative and Performing Arts in Education, to create a contemporary dance work.
